oracle数据库:
或
SQLServer数据库:
mysql数据库:
DB2数据库:
或
- SELECT
- *
- FROM
- user
- WHERE
- name like CONCAT('%',#{name},'%')
或
- SELECT
- *
- FROM
- user
- WHERE
- name like '%'||#{name}||'%'
SQLServer数据库:
- SELECT
- *
- FROM
- user
- WHERE
- name like '%'+#{name}+'%'
mysql数据库:
- SELECT
- *
- FROM
- user
- WHERE
- name like CONCAT('%',#{name},'%')
DB2数据库:
- SELECT
- *
- FROM
- user
- WHERE
- name like CONCAT('%',#{name},'%')
或
- SELECT
- *
- FROM
- user
- WHERE
- name like '%'||#{name}||'%'
本文介绍了一种在多种数据库中实现模糊查询的方法,包括Oracle、SQLServer、MySQL和DB2等,通过示例展示了如何使用Java代码进行姓名字段的模糊匹配。

1689

被折叠的 条评论
为什么被折叠?



